On the Waterfront

The Brian Lehrer Show | Mar 31, 2010
Lisa Kersavage, Kress/RFR fellow of historic preservation and public policy at The Municipal Art Society, Julia Vitullo-Martin, Senior Fellow at The Manhattan Institute and Director of the Center for Rethinking Development, and NYC Councilman David Yassky (D-Brooklyn 33rd), discuss the designation of Brooklyn’s industrial waterfront as one of the The National Trust for Historic Preservation’s 11 most endangered sites.
